Brian Tracy, author involving Maximum Achievement, determines six requirements for achievement. These requirements are usually peace of mind, good health plus a high level of energy, adoring relationships, financial flexibility, commitment to worthy objectives and ideals, and a feeling of personal satisfaction or self-actualization. If you take an end look at each of these items, they are all about who you are, not what you perform.
